SEIGLE v. RICHARDSON

No. 37102.

317 P.2d 767 (1957)

Maurice SEIGLE et al., Plaintiffs in Error, v. Maude S. RICHARDSON, Defendant in Error.

Supreme Court of Oklahoma.

Dissenting Opinion July 9, 1957.

Rehearing Denied July 9, 1957.

Application for Leave to File Second Petition for Rehearing Denied November 19, 1957.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

C.C. Wilkins, Marietta, for plaintiffs in error.

Earl Q. Gray, Ardmore, for defendant in error.


JACKSON, Justice.

This action was instituted by Maude S. Richardson against Maurice Seigle, et al., in the District Court of Love County, Oklahoma, to quiet title to the SE 1/4 of the NE 1/4 of Section 11, Township 6 South; Range 3 West, in Love County, Oklahoma.

From the judgment in favor of the plaintiff, defendants appeal.
